Check if You QualifyAn IVA in Cardiff is a formal agreement managed by a Licensed Insolvency Practitioner that allows you to make one affordable monthly payment for five to six years, after which remaining unsecured debt is written off. It is legally binding, freezes interest and charges, and prevents creditors from contacting you.
